A large stainless steel military chronograph wristwatch

The present Universal Genève Compur has a large 38mm case, black dial and silver print.

The watch was made for the German Luftwaffe as attested by the RLM engraving on the case back. RLM which stands for Reichs luftsfahr ministerium (Minsistry of Aviation) was in activity between 1933 and 1945. The numbers 5453 indicates most certainly an issue number.

Considering the clean condition of the case with sharp angles and crisp edges, it is safe to assume the watch spent very little time strapped on a pilot’s wrist.

Universal

Swiss | 1894

Universal Genève was founded in Le Locle, Switzerland in 1894 and was originally known as "Universal Watch." Since its inception, Universal Genève has produced watches with unusually high quality for their price point. Universal was among the first brands to introduce a chronograph wristwatch.


Today, the firm's vintage models are highly sought-after and desired for their oversized cases and interesting dial designs. Key models include a variety of "Compax" models such as the "Nina Rindt" or "Evil Nina," the Uni-Compax, the Space-Compax, the Aero-Compax and the Film-Compax.
